							| @@ -0,0 +1,57 @@ | ||||
| //! Blocking shared SPI bus | ||||
| use core::cell::RefCell; | ||||
|  | ||||
| use embassy::blocking_mutex::raw::RawMutex; | ||||
| use embassy::blocking_mutex::Mutex; | ||||
| use embedded_hal_1::digital::blocking::OutputPin; | ||||
| use embedded_hal_1::spi; | ||||
| use embedded_hal_1::spi::blocking::{SpiBusFlush, SpiDevice}; | ||||
|  | ||||
| use crate::shared_bus::spi::SpiBusDeviceError; | ||||
|  | ||||
| pub struct SpiBusDevice<'a, M: RawMutex, BUS, CS> { | ||||
|     bus: &'a Mutex<M, RefCell<BUS>>, | ||||
|     cs: CS, | ||||
| } | ||||
|  | ||||
| impl<'a, M: RawMutex, BUS, CS> SpiBusDevice<'a, M, BUS, CS> { | ||||
|     pub fn new(bus: &'a Mutex<M, RefCell<BUS>>, cs: CS) -> Self { | ||||
|         Self { bus, cs } | ||||
|     } | ||||
| } | ||||
|  | ||||
| impl<'a, M: RawMutex, BUS, CS> spi::ErrorType for SpiBusDevice<'a, M, BUS, CS> | ||||
| where | ||||
|     BUS: spi::ErrorType, | ||||
|     CS: OutputPin, | ||||
| { | ||||
|     type Error = SpiBusDeviceError<BUS::Error, CS::Error>; | ||||
| } | ||||
|  | ||||
| impl<BUS, M, CS> SpiDevice for SpiBusDevice<'_, M, BUS, CS> | ||||
| where | ||||
|     M: RawMutex, | ||||
|     BUS: SpiBusFlush, | ||||
|     CS: OutputPin, | ||||
| { | ||||
|     type Bus = BUS; | ||||
|  | ||||
|     fn transaction<R>(&mut self, f: impl FnOnce(&mut Self::Bus) -> Result<R, BUS::Error>) -> Result<R, Self::Error> { | ||||
|         self.bus.lock(|bus| { | ||||
|             let mut bus = bus.borrow_mut(); | ||||
|             self.cs.set_low().map_err(SpiBusDeviceError::Cs)?; | ||||
|  | ||||
|             let f_res = f(&mut bus); | ||||
|  | ||||
|             // On failure, it's important to still flush and deassert CS. | ||||
|             let flush_res = bus.flush(); | ||||
|             let cs_res = self.cs.set_high(); | ||||
|  | ||||
|             let f_res = f_res.map_err(SpiBusDeviceError::Spi)?; | ||||
|             flush_res.map_err(SpiBusDeviceError::Spi)?; | ||||
|             cs_res.map_err(SpiBusDeviceError::Cs)?; | ||||
|  | ||||
|             Ok(f_res) | ||||
|         }) | ||||
|     } | ||||
| } | ||||
